Genesis 35

16 Ref So they went on from Beth-el; and while they were still some distance from Ephrath, the pains of birth came on Rachel and she had a hard time.

17 Ref And when her pain was very great, the woman who was helping her said, Have no fear; for now you will have another son.

18 Ref And in the hour when her life went from her (for death came to her), she gave the child the name Ben-oni: but his father gave him the name of Benjamin.

19 Ref So Rachel came to her end and was put to rest on the road to Ephrath (which is Beth-lehem).

20 Ref And Jacob put up a pillar on her resting-place; which is named, The Pillar of the resting-place of Rachel, to this day.

21 Ref And Israel went journeying on and put up his tents on the other side of the tower of the flock.

22 Ref Now while they were living in that country, Reuben had connection with Bilhah, his father's servant-woman: and Israel had news of it.

23 Ref Now Jacob had twelve sons: the sons of Leah: Reuben, Jacob's first son, and Simeon and Levi and Judah and Issachar and Zebulun;

24 Ref The sons of Rachel: Joseph and Benjamin;

25 Ref The sons of Bilhah, Rachel's servant: Dan and Naphtali;

26 Ref The sons of Zilpah, Leah's servant: Gad and Asher; these are the sons whom Jacob had in Paddan-aram.
